Lynn Duncan is an Associate Professor of Nursing and Clinical Education Center Coordinator at Colorado Mesa University. She holds a BSN from South Dakota State University (1989) and an MSN with a cognate in Education from Colorado Mesa University (2014). She also earned a Graduate Certificate in Healthcare Simulation from Boise State University (2018).
Her academic focus centers on nursing education and clinical practice, with expertise in healthcare simulation methodologies. Her professional roles emphasize bridging theoretical knowledge with practical clinical skills in nursing education.
